Multi-Award Winning Team Brings Groundbreaking 1950s Lesbian Pulp Novels to the Stage

Set in pre-Stonewall Greenwich Village, THE BEEBO BRINKER CHRONICLES celebrates the era when "the love that dares not speak its name" began breaking the old rules. Fueled by booze and furtive sex, the play follows the lives and loves of Laura, Beth and Beebo as they navigate uncharted territories of desire. Beth and Laura, secret lovers in college, went separate ways after graduation: Beth married and had children, Laura moved to New York. Both pine for each other, but before they can reunite, they find themselves entangled in the web of Beebo Brinker, a butch denizen of the bars with a soft spot for young lesbians fresh off the bus.
About the Company: Hourglass Group
Hourglass Group (Elyse Singer, Artistic Director) has been producing new plays and neglected vintage American comedies since 1999. In addition to producing the highly acclaimed TROUBLE IN PARADISE last season (which earned an Obie Award for actress Nina Hellman), other credits include the first revivals of Mae West’s plays SEX and THE PLEASURE MAN (starring Charles Busch), Ruth Margraff’s Red Frogs at P.S. 122 and Deborah Swisher’s Hundreds of Sisters & One BIG Brother. In addition to BEEBO, Hourglass Group’s 2007-08 season will also feature Ruth Margraff’s gypsy opera WELLSPRING and the premiere of Elyse Singer’s award-winning multidisciplinary work about Hedy Lamarr and George Antheil, FREQUENCY HOPPING, at 3LD Art & Technology Center.
